​The Coffee hour podcast for dog guardians 

Picture
One thing that dog professionals have an abundance of is podcasts and unique learning, this can be overwhelming for dog guardians, this is why the "Coffee hour" was born, so that dog guardians have an easy listen podcast to learn more intrinsically and holistically how to meet your dogs needs.

Every second friday of the month, live in the Miyagis Dog Training Commmunity, available on both Youtube and Spotify after the session, guardians and professionals a like welcome and we give notice of the speaker and the topic to give you lots of opportunities to ask or prepare questions, ahead of time.

Episodes 


Episode 1 - IVDD - Intervertebral Disc Disease with Liz Bean Lidstone. Liz is a qualified dog trainer and behaviourist who currently shares a home with two guinea pigs, an opinionated cat and a wonderful assistance dog River. Liz will be drawing on personal experiences of IVDD, having shared this journey her beloved Jack Russell Rune.
By raising awareness of IVDD Liz aim's to teach owners how to recognise the signs- because with this condition time is of the essence and the steps taken early on are critical to improving the outcome for the dog.

Episode 2 - Claire will be talking with Tasha about Hydrotherapy for dogs. What is it, how it can help, what it can help with and most importantly the fun we and the dogs have doing it.
Who is Claire?
Claire has owned dogs for 16 years as well as being brought up with them during her childhood. She has been very active in the dog world, in showing, water rescue training, agility, carting and dog training, either as a participant, helper or both.
Claire will explain how her experience with disease and arthritis in her dogs, led to herself and partner at the time to decide to start up their own Hydrotherapy Centre. Claire will talk about the many mistakes they made in their experience with their own dogs, which has helped them guide many others in the right direction for theirs.


Episode 3 - Laura will be joining Tasha  to discuss her experiences of working in rescue. Laura will be talking about positive reinforcement, management and setting dogs up for success within a rescue centre setting without the need to use aversives. Laura has a rescue dog herself called Luna who is absolutely gorgeous and Laura is also a member of the PPG Assistance Animal Division.
​


Episode 4 - Natalie will be joining Tasha to debunk the misconceptions of small breed dogs. Natalie runs NK9 Dog Training & Behaviour and works with myself as a lot of you know, she is a member of the SIT- INTODogs Social Inclusion Team, a Ppgbi member, approved trainer and behaviourist with The Association of INTODogs, an approved trainer with KAD Kids Around Dogs and a Dog Parkour UK approved Instructor and assessor. Small dogs breeds are a big topic that has had a lot of frought and heated debates over the years and this podcast is going to focus on changing the perceptions of small breed dogs and what the general public can do to help! 

Episode 5 - In this episode we discuss the benefits of play and troubleshooting play with dogs, how to help dogs who aren't naturally play driven and find it difficult to play as well as how to help dogs who are nervous and unable to cope outside in the world, through the power of play!
